our model

Men’s groups

5–10 men per group — intentionally small

Weekly meetings at consistent, recurring times

Morning coffee shops, lunch workspaces, late afternoon gatherings

Hosted away from churches — inter-congregational by design

Regular recreational outings: skiing, fishing, hiking, biking

every meeting

First half: Life check-in — wins and losses. No golf scores. Real life.

Second half: Curriculum — spiritual formation, emotional health

8 Week Curriculum Covering:

Identity, Purpose & the Man I Want to Become

Marriage, Singleness & Fatherhood

Brotherhood, Friendship & Accountability

Vocation, Calling & the Sacred Nature of Work

Avocation, Leisure & the Rhythm of Rest

Service, Generosity & Community Engagement

Character, Integrity & Resilience

Leadership, Influence & Legacy

who we serve

Men navigating real-life challenges that don't get discussed in the typical men's gathering

relationships

Divorce, broken marriages, challenging parenting situations, loneliness and isolation

Work & Purpose

Finding meaning in work, work-life balance, job dislocation, career transitions

identity & faith

Who am I? Why am I here? Is faith real and relevant to how I live day-to-day?
